What is EdgeDB?

Editorial review
Gel is an integrated data platform built on top of PostgreSQL, designed to modernize the relational database experience. It provides a fresh approach to data modeling with object types and links instead of traditional JOINs, simplifying complex queries and migrations. Gel offers a complete database workflow from local development to cloud deployment with zero-config setup, built-in tooling, and robust client libraries for various programming languages. Gel is targeted at developers looking for a more intuitive and efficient way to interact with Postgres, especially those working with modern application stacks. It addresses common database challenges like N+1 problems, complex migrations, and schema management. Key benefits include end-to-end type safety, integrated authentication, AI/GenAI readiness with vector stores and RAG endpoints, and high performance due to query composability and optimized network interactions. The platform is fully open source and provides features like graph queries, a high-level schema engine, and client SDKs for Python, TypeScript, Go, Dart, Rust, .NET, and Java. It also includes tools for local development, cloud deployment with encryption and backups, and integrations with platforms like Vercel and GitHub.

EdgeDB FAQ

How does EdgeDB simplify data modeling compared to traditional relational databases?

EdgeDB modernizes the relational database experience by using object types and links for data modeling, which replaces traditional JOINs. This approach simplifies complex queries and streamlines schema management for developers.

Which teams would benefit most from using EdgeDB?

EdgeDB is ideal for developers working with modern application stacks who need an intuitive and efficient way to interact with Postgres. It particularly suits teams looking to address challenges like N+1 problems, complex migrations, and schema management.

How does EdgeDB compare to PostgreSQL regarding query capabilities?

EdgeDB enhances PostgreSQL by offering a modern data model and graph queries, which can simplify complex data interactions. While PostgreSQL provides a robust relational foundation, EdgeDB adds a high-level schema engine and optimized query composability.

Can EdgeDB be used for AI and GenAI applications?

Yes, EdgeDB is designed to be AI/GenAI ready, incorporating features like vector stores and RAG (Retrieval Augmented Generation) endpoints. This makes it suitable for applications requiring advanced data retrieval and processing for AI models.

What kind of trade-offs should users consider when adopting EdgeDB?

Users should be aware that EdgeDB currently has a smaller ecosystem and community compared to more established database solutions. There may also be a learning curve associated with its modern data model and fewer hosting options available.

Does EdgeDB support various programming languages through client libraries?

Yes, EdgeDB provides robust client SDKs for a wide array of programming languages. These include Python, TypeScript, Go, Dart, Rust, .NET, and Java, facilitating integration into diverse application environments.
